On Deformations of Gorenstein-Projective Modules over Monomial Algebras with no Overlaps

Abstract

Let k\mathbf{k} be a field of arbitrary characteristic, let Λ\Lambda be a finite dimensional k\mathbf{k}-algebra, and let VV be an indecomposable Gorenstein-projective Λ\Lambda-module with finite dimension over k\mathbf{k}. It follows that VV has a well-defined versal deformation ring R(Λ,V)R(\Lambda, V), which is complete local commutative Noetherian k\mathbf{k}-algebra with residue field k\mathbf{k}, and which is universal provided that the stable endomorphism ring of VV is isomorphic to k\mathbf{k}. We prove that if Λ\Lambda is a monomial algebra without overlaps, then R(Λ,V)R(\Lambda,V) is universal and isomorphic either to k\mathbf{k} or to k[[t]]/(t2)\mathbf{k}[[t]]/(t^2)
